Bitcoin Casino Bonuses: What You Actually Get

“Up to 5 BTC free!” screams the banner. Then you read the terms: x45 wagering, maximum bet 0.0001 BTC, and only slots with an RTP of 94% count. That’s not a bonus; it’s a statistical money furnace. We’ve seen enough of these to fill a sarcasm bingo card.

The reality: Bitcoin casino bonuses in 2026 have improved slightly from the Wild West days of 2020, but they’re still engineered to deliver house edge. Welcome packages typically split across three to four deposits. For instance, a “5 BTC bonus” might be a 125% match on your first deposit up to 1 BTC, then 75% on the second, and so on. You never get the full 5 BTC unless you deposit several coins yourself—and meet the playthrough.

Provably Fair Games

This is where Bitcoin casinos can outshine traditional ones. Provably fair algorithms let you independently verify each game outcome using cryptographic hashes generated before you even place a bet. Most reputable sites offer a verification page where you input server and client seeds to check the result. It’s not a guarantee of “fairness” in the cosmic sense—the casino still has a mathematical edge—but it assures you the result wasn’t altered after you bet. Common provably fair games include crash (like Aviator), dice (classic and under/over), Plinko, and original card games.

Is It Legal? The UK’s Stance on Bitcoin Gambling in 2026

Short answer: Bitcoin gambling isn’t explicitly illegal, but it operates in a grey zone. The Gambling Act 2005 and subsequent regulations don’t mention cryptocurrency. The UKGC’s position, however, is that any operator providing gambling facilities to British residents must hold a UKGC licence—and none do for crypto. The regulator has refused to certify casinos that accept Bitcoin, citing concerns over anti-money laundering (AML) and customer protection.

This doesn’t make you a criminal for playing. UK residents are not prosecuted for gambling on offshore crypto sites. The law targets operators, not individual players. But you lose the legal recourse that UKGC-licensed platforms offer: no ADR (alternative dispute resolution) body, no Financial Ombudsman, and no statutory cooling-off protection.

Tax-wise, gambling winnings in the UK remain tax-free for players, whether in pounds or Bitcoin. However, if you convert large sums of BTC back to fiat, your bank may flag it and ask questions about the source of funds. Keep records. The HMRC hasn’t issued specific guidance on crypto gambling wins, but existing tax principles likely treat them as gambling profits, which are not subject to income or capital gains tax for individuals.

Safety and Provably Fair: Can You Trust a Bitcoin Casino?

Trust is the expensive commodity in crypto gambling. Since you can’t rely on a regulator to force a refund, you must rely on three things: operational transparency, community reputation, and technical verification.

Operational transparency: The best casinos publish their hot wallet addresses, undergo publicized security audits (we’ve seen firms like CertiK and Hacken audit some platforms, though not all), and maintain active communication channels on Telegram or Discord. If a site goes silent for two weeks after a “maintenance” upgrade, run.

Community reputation: Forums like Bitcointalk’s gambling section are full of brutally honest reviews. Players post proof of deposits and withdrawals, and any casino that slow-pays or scams is quickly exposed. Check the “Scam accusations” board before depositing. A lack of complaints isn’t always a green flag; sometimes it means the casino is too new to have been tested.

Technical verification: This is where provably fair games shine. By providing the hash of the server seed before you play, the casino makes it impossible to change the outcome after your bet. You can verify each round using open-source tools. Not all games are provably fair—Evolution live feeds are not, for instance—but the ones that are give you a level of assurance that traditional RNG audits (which you can’t independently verify) never could.
